Boiler Kettling Or Banging
The boiler rumbles, whistles or bangs like a kettle coming to the boil when the heating fires.

What's happening?
Kettling is exactly what it sounds like: water boiling and flashing to steam inside the boiler's heat exchanger, then collapsing back — the same noise a kettle makes. It happens when water cannot move through the exchanger fast enough to carry the heat away, so localised patches reach boiling point. The two causes are almost always restriction and scale. Limescale forms on the hottest surfaces in hard-water areas; magnetite sludge builds up in the narrow waterways of a modern exchanger and does the same thing. Banging and knocking that come and go with the pump are a different noise with a related cause — trapped air, an overspeeding pump, or pipework that expands against a joist and releases with a crack.
What usually causes it?
- Limescale on the heat exchanger surfaces in a hard-water area
- Magnetite sludge restricting flow through the exchanger's waterways
- A pump set too slow, or failing, so flow through the boiler is inadequate
- Thermostatic radiator valves all closed at once with no bypass, starving the boiler of a circuit
- A partially blocked or closed isolation valve on the boiler's flow or return
- Air trapped in the boiler or the pipework directly above it
- A faulty boiler thermostat letting flow temperature run higher than it should
Is it dangerous?
Moderate. Boilers have overheat protection and will lock out rather than run away, so the immediate risk is low, but persistent kettling stresses the heat exchanger and shortens its life, and a heat exchanger is the most expensive part on the appliance. Loud banging can also be pipework moving under thermal stress, which eventually opens a joint. Do not ignore a boiler that has started making a noise it never used to make.
Can I fix it myself?
A little. Check the system pressure is in the right band, since low pressure reduces flow. Bleed the radiators and any towel rail to clear trapped air. Open a couple of radiator valves fully so the boiler always has somewhere to send heat, particularly if every room has a thermostatic valve that closes. Turn the boiler's flow temperature down a notch and see whether the noise reduces. Beyond that, descaling and flushing use chemicals and equipment that need to go in and come back out properly, and opening the boiler is not a homeowner task.
When should you call a heating engineer?
Call a heating engineer if the noise persists after bleeding and a pressure check, if it has appeared suddenly, or if it comes with radiators that are cold at the bottom. Call promptly if the boiler is also locking out on an overheat fault, because that combination points at a restricted exchanger. On a gas boiler, whoever works on it must be Gas Safe registered.
What will the heating engineer actually do?
- Measure flow and return temperatures across the boiler to quantify the restriction
- Check pump performance and speed setting, and replace a failing pump
- Chemically descale or flush the heat exchanger, or replace it where it is beyond cleaning
- Clean the system, dose with inhibitor and fit or service a magnetic filter
- Fit or reinstate an automatic bypass valve where thermostatic valves can close every circuit
- Secure pipework clips and add expansion allowance where banging is thermal movement
